Cervical Cancer: Understanding the Trends, Risks, and Prevention

"A comprehensive look at the rising trends in cervical cancer, including early detection, HPV's role, and modern treatment strategies."


Cervical cancer is a type of malignant carcinoma originating in the cervix, the opening between the uterus and vagina. It is characterized by abnormal cell growth. The area where these changes typically begin is called the "transformation zone," making it a primary focus for early detection efforts.

The majority of cervical cancers are squamous cell carcinomas, arising from the squamous epithelial cells lining the cervix. Adenocarcinomas, developing in the glandular epithelial cells, are the second most common type. Understanding these different types is crucial for effective diagnosis and treatment planning.

It's essential to recognize that human papillomavirus (HPV) plays a significant role in over 90% of cervical cancer cases. While most individuals with HPV infections do not develop cervical cancer, the virus remains a key risk factor. Other factors, such as smoking, weakened immune systems, the use of oral contraceptives, early onset of sexual activity, and multiple sexual partners, also contribute to the risk, although to a lesser extent.

Early Detection: The Power of Screening

Cervical cancer often starts with precancerous changes that can be detected through regular screening, typically over a span of 10 to 20 years. Around 90% of cervical cancer cases are squamous cell carcinomas, while about 10% are adenocarcinomas, with a few other distinctive types. Regular cervical screening, followed by a biopsy if needed, is vital for early detection.

The Papanicolaou test, or Pap smear, is a critical tool for checking the cervix and has significantly reduced the occurrence and mortality rates of cervical cancer in many countries. Regular Pap smear screenings, with appropriate follow-up, can decrease the rate of cervical infections by up to 80%. Abnormal results can indicate precancerous changes, allowing for thorough examination and preventive treatment.

While early detection is paramount, it's important to understand the available treatment options. The approach to treatment varies worldwide and depends on factors like access to specialized care and the stage of the cancer. For instance, microinvasive diseases (stage IA) may be managed with hysterectomy, while early stages (IB1 and IIA under 4 cm) can be treated with radical hysterectomy or radiation therapy. The goal is to eradicate the cancer while considering the patient’s overall health and desires.
